IMEG is hiring a Full Stack Software Engineer in Las Vegas, NV to support software design, coding, and internal system development as part of the company’s development team.
The role requires a Bachelor’s degree in Computer Science or CIS or equivalent, 3+ years of programming in a team environment, and knowledge of C#, HTML5, and JavaScript. Remote-eligible with a strong collaboration culture and ESOP ownership.
